Transaction 22886803225c37655e8331ba91aa5cd93348b304554892e77744fadf78d05bd8
1 Input
1 Output
-
22886803225c37655e8331ba91aa5cd93348b304554892e77744fadf78d05bd8:0
- value
- 17797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84a50f07175cc78f767ff941220fd11d740f0b29 OP_EQUAL
- address
- 3DnNrLxxW3C4VmJxbMQS8rqcH3zaV1zGg3